JVM crash with ~BufferBlob::Interpreter in fatal error log stack

Solution Verified - Updated -

Issue

  • JVM crash with ~BufferBlob::Interpreter in fatal error log stack. For example:
    Java frames: (J=compiled Java code, j=interpreted, Vv=VM code)
    J  java.util.zip.ZipFile.getEntry(JLjava/lang/String;Z)J
    J  sun.misc.URLClassPath$JarLoader.getResource(Ljava/lang/String;Z)Lsun/misc/Resource;
    J  java.net.URLClassLoader$2.run()Ljava/lang/Object;
    v  ~BufferBlob::StubRoutines (1)
    J  java.security.AccessController.doPrivileged(Ljava/security/PrivilegedAction;Ljava/security/AccessControlContext;)Ljava/lang/Object;
    J  org.jboss.mx.loading.LoadMgr3.beginLoadTask(Lorg/jboss/mx/loading/ClassLoadingTask;Lorg/jboss/mx/loading/UnifiedLoaderRepository3;)Z
    v  ~BufferBlob::Interpreter
    J  org.jboss.mx.loading.RepositoryClassLoader.loadClass(Ljava/lang/String;Z)Ljava/lang/Class;
    v  ~BufferBlob::Interpreter
    v  ~BufferBlob::Interpreter
    v  ~BufferBlob::Interpreter
    v  ~BufferBlob::Interpreter
    v  ~BufferBlob::Interpreter
    v  ~BufferBlob::Interpreter
    ...
